When Meadowlark clients drop and fail to reconnect, check the Perchline gateway first: the bug is a stale session token surviving past the handshake reset. The fix in the pending patch clears the token on close events. Verify against the staging replay before approving. The reproducing build's trace token is below.

build token for kagaf-hahof: htk14_9d3d4d26d7d8de

Ticket: OPS-3391 — Expired credentials during cron drift investigation

While investigating why nightly jobs on the Harwick scheduler drift later each week, we found the drift-probe agent has been silently failing since its credential for the internal TickTrace API expired. That means two weeks of missing timing data, which explains the gaps in our graphs. New team members: the probe won't alert on auth failures, so check this first. The replacement key is below.

gateway credential: kto3_qfe

**Action item (PM-214):** The Gatewell ticket-pricing experiment overran its traffic allocation because ramp limits were hardcoded in two places. Consolidate all experiment caps into the shared config module and add a reviewer checklist entry. Reviewer: confirm the new single source of truth matches the values below.

limits module of tawip-yahag:
QUOTAS = {
    "wenwyn": 1,
    "oliwyn": 10,
}